What Is a Notary Public?
A notary public is an official authorized by the state to witness and certify the signing of documents. This role involves verifying identities, ensuring the understanding of documents, and preventing fraud. Notaries public play a vital part in various transactions, including real estate sales, legal agreements, and financial contracts.
Responsibilities of a notary public include:
- Witnessing Signatures: They confirm the identities of signers, ensuring that documents are signed willingly and without coercion.
- Administering Oaths: Notaries public can administer oaths, affirmations, and acknowledgments for legal testimonies and affidavits.
- Certifying Copies: They provide certified copies of important documents, which may be required in legal or governmental procedures.
Notaries public must adhere to strict ethical standards and state regulations. Their presence enhances the credibility and legality of documents, making their services essential in various legal and business contexts. Finding a Notary Near Me Within 0.2 Mi
Locating a notary public within a short distance enhances the efficiency of document processing. Numerous search methods and online resources simplify the task of finding a nearby notary.
Search Methods
- Use Maps Applications: Individuals can leverage GPS-based maps, like Google Maps or Apple Maps, to input “notary near me.” These applications display notary locations, hours, and user reviews.
- Ask for Recommendations: Seeking suggestions from friends, family, or colleagues often leads to trusted local notaries. Personal recommendations provide insights into reliability and service quality.
- Check with Local Businesses: Many banks, law firms, and real estate offices offer notary services. Direct inquiries can reveal nearby options and availability for immediate assistance.
- Utilize Social Media: Community groups on platforms like Facebook or Nextdoor allow individuals to post inquiries about local notary services. Users often share experiences and suggestions, leading to effective connections.
Online Resources and Directories
- Notary Locator Websites: Specialized websites, such as NotaryRotary and 123notary, allow users to search notary directories based on ZIP code and proximity. These platforms often include reviews and contact details.
- State Notary Websites: Many states maintain official directories of licensed notaries, searchable by county or city. Accessing state resources ensures verification of credentials and legal compliance.
- Legal Services Portals: Websites focused on legal assistance often feature notary services among their offerings. These platforms provide user-friendly search functionalities and detailed information on notaries.
- Freelance Platforms: Websites like Thumbtack or TaskRabbit connect users with mobile notaries available for in-home appointments. These platforms facilitate quick access to notary services at convenient times.
